Look Beyond the Welcome Bonus
Promotional banners often highlight a large deposit match or a collection of free spins. The headline figure is only one part of the value. Wagering requirements, maximum bet limits, eligible games, time restrictions and withdrawal conditions can significantly change the real cost of accepting an offer.
Before claiming a promotion, check whether the bonus balance must be played through separately from the deposit. Some casinos apply different contribution rates to slots, table games and live dealer titles. A clear promotion page should explain these rules without forcing players to search through several unrelated sections.
- Confirm the minimum deposit required for eligibility.
- Compare wagering requirements with the bonus amount and expiry period.
- Check whether selected games are excluded or limited.
- Review maximum winnings and withdrawal restrictions.
- Read the rules for cancelling an active promotion.
Assess Licensing, Security and Fairness
Trust begins with verifiable regulation. A reputable operator normally displays its licensing details, company information and responsible gambling policies in an accessible footer or help centre. The licence should be checked against the regulator’s public records rather than accepted solely because a badge appears on the website.
Secure connections, encrypted transactions and identity verification are equally important. Know-your-customer checks may feel inconvenient, but they help prevent fraud and protect account holders. A casino that explains why documents are requested, how they are stored and which formats are accepted creates a stronger sense of accountability.

Match the Casino to Your Playing Habits
Not every platform serves the same audience. Slot enthusiasts may prioritise game variety, progressive jackpots and useful filters. Players who prefer blackjack, roulette or baccarat may care more about table limits, rule variations and live dealer availability. A smaller lobby can still be attractive if its catalogue is well curated and easy to navigate.
Mobile performance should also be tested before a substantial deposit. A reliable site loads quickly on a smartphone, keeps the cashier easy to reach and preserves game settings across screen sizes. Native applications can be convenient, but a well-optimised browser version may provide a similar experience without an additional download.
Payment Speed Deserves Special Attention
Deposits are commonly processed immediately, while withdrawals can involve manual review. Compare the minimum and maximum transaction amounts, supported currencies, fees and expected processing windows. E-wallets may be faster than bank transfers, whereas card withdrawals can depend on the issuing bank and local rules.
Players should also confirm that the chosen method is available in their jurisdiction. A payment icon shown on the general website does not guarantee access for every customer. Checking the cashier after registration, before depositing, can prevent an avoidable mismatch.
Use Responsible Gambling Tools
A dependable casino treats entertainment as a budgeted activity rather than a source of income. Deposit limits, session reminders, cooling-off periods and self-exclusion options allow users to maintain control. These tools are most effective when activated before play becomes stressful or losses begin to influence decisions.
Set a personal spending limit, avoid borrowing to gamble and never increase stakes solely to recover previous losses. If gambling stops feeling recreational, pause the account and contact a recognised support organisation. A responsible operator should make these options visible rather than hiding them behind complicated menus.
